
Phenomena Labs is a contemporary art studio exploring the relationship between natural systems and computational processes. Founded by Ronen Tanchum, the studio produces generative and immersive works that behave as living environments. Grounded in principles of growth, decay, and emergence, each work unfolds as a real-time system shaped by data, environment, and human presence. Technology is treated as a material. The works create conditions where viewers enter, influence, and become part of evolving systems. Phenomena Labs operates across exhibitions, institutional collaborations, and site-specific installations.
